Eaton Vance Senior Income Closed Fund (EVF) - Total Liabilities

Latest as of December 2025: $24.06 Million USD

Based on the latest financial reports, Eaton Vance Senior Income Closed Fund (EVF) has total liabilities worth $24.06 Million USD as of December 2025.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ities. Annual Total Liabilities for Eaton Vance Senior Income Closed Fund (2006–2025)

The table below shows the annual total liabilities of Eaton Vance Senior Income Closed Fund from 2006 to 2025.

Year Total Liabilities Change
2025-06-30 $63.90 Million +152.09%
2024-06-30 $25.35 Million -61.92%
2023-06-30 $66.57 Million +138.35%
2022-06-30 $27.93 Million -74.60%
2021-06-30 $109.96 Million -44.11%
2020-06-30 $196.73 Million +63.50%
2019-06-30 $120.33 Million +5.77%
2018-06-30 $113.76 Million +13.60%
2017-06-30 $100.14 Million +150.17%
2016-06-30 $40.03 Million -44.48%
2015-06-30 $72.10 Million -4.42%
2014-06-30 $75.44 Million -13.74%
2013-06-30 $87.45 Million -20.46%
2008-06-30 $109.94 Million -16.33%
2007-06-30 $131.41 Million +6.79%
2006-06-30 $123.05 Million --

Eaton Vance Senior Income Trust is a closed-ended fixed income mutual fund launched and managed by Eaton Vance Management. The fund invests in the fixed income markets of the United States. It seeks to invest in the securities of companies operating across the diversified sectors. The fund primarily invests in senior secured floating rate loans.
